智慧教育在线考试系统的高并发处理方案

首页 / 新闻资讯 / 智慧教育在线考试系统的高并发处理方案

智慧教育在线考试系统的高并发处理方案

📅 2026-04-30 🔖 智慧党建,智慧教育,智慧交通,智慧物业

在智慧教育快速普及的今天,在线考试系统已成为教学评估的核心工具。然而,当数千甚至数万考生同时涌入系统时,流量洪峰往往导致页面白屏、提交失败甚至服务器宕机。作为深耕智慧党建、智慧教育、智慧交通、智慧物业等领域的技术服务商,航科实验室科技有限公司结合多年高并发场景实战经验,解析智慧教育在线考试系统的可靠方案。

高并发压力的根源与应对逻辑

在线考试系统的并发压力并非随机爆发,而是集中在开考、交卷两个瞬间。例如,某省公务员考试系统曾因30万考生同时登录,导致数据库连接池耗尽。核心矛盾在于:传统单体架构的请求排队机制无法应对瞬间流量。我们的方案采用微服务+消息队列架构,将用户请求先写入Kafka队列,再由后端服务异步消费。这样即便请求量是正常值的20倍,系统也能平滑处理,类似于智慧交通中红绿灯的潮汐车道控制逻辑。

实操方法:三大关键优化点

第一,读写分离与缓存预热。在考试前2小时,系统将题库、考生名单等静态数据加载至Redis集群,避免考试期间频繁查询数据库。第二,弹性伸缩策略。我们利用Kubernetes HPA机制,根据CPU和请求延迟自动扩容Pod副本数。例如,某次省级统考中,系统在5分钟内从20个节点扩展至150个节点。第三,分布式限流与熔断。在Nginx层配置令牌桶算法,对单个IP的请求速率进行限制;同时采用Sentinel实现服务降级,当下游服务响应超时(如超过800ms)时自动熔断,防止雪崩效应。

数据对比:优化前后的性能差异

以某智慧教育平台的真实压测数据为例:在5000人并发提交答案的场景下,优化前系统吞吐量(TPS)仅为320,平均响应时间4.2秒,且有12%的请求超时失败;而采用上述方案后,TPS提升至2100,响应时间降至0.8秒,错误率低于0.3%。值得注意的是,数据库连接数从峰值1200降至120,资源利用率显著优化。这套方案同样可复用于智慧物业的物业费收缴高峰、智慧党建的线上投票活动,其核心是“削峰填谷”与“资源弹性”的深度结合。

在智慧教育的实际部署中,我们还会根据考试时段调整资源优先级。例如,开考前10分钟,重点保障登录接口的响应;考试期间则侧重答题数据的实时持久化。这种端到端的全链路优化,需要从DNS解析、CDN加速到应用层代码的协同。航科实验室的监控平台会实时展示每个微服务的调用链耗时,一旦发现某个环节出现瓶颈(如Redis集群的QPS接近上限),系统会自动触发扩容或切换备用节点。

从智慧交通的红绿灯调度到智慧物业的门禁并发,再到智慧教育的在线考试,高并发处理的核心始终是解耦与异步。通过将同步请求转为异步任务,配合动态资源池和精细化限流,才能让系统在流量洪峰中稳如磐石。航科实验室科技有限公司将持续迭代这一技术框架,为各行业数字化场景提供经得起实战检验的底层支撑。

相关推荐

📄

智慧交通车路协同方案在城市快速路的应用

2026-04-30

📄

智慧党建平台技术架构设计与安全合规要点解析

2026-05-20

📄

智慧交通信号控制系统技术演进路线分析

2026-05-05

📄

智慧物业能耗管理模块与楼宇自控系统对接方案

2026-04-25

📄

智慧教育互动课堂服务器负载均衡架构设计

2026-04-29

📄

智慧党建在线学习平台的内容安全审核技术

2026-05-04